Boxers or briefs? Willow is having a bad day. To get her sister to stop harassing her, she agrees to play a silly game-but only once. When a muscular hunk walks past her, Willow's mouth waters and she knows she's found the perfect man to ask her embarrassing question. Seth is shocked when a beautiful woman sits on his lap. He's amused when she begins asking him questions. But he's aroused when she kisses him. Taking her back to his home, he sinks his teeth into her-and is addicted. Imagine his surprise when he finds out she holds his life in the palm of her hands. What's a vampire to do when the woman he needs for his survival runs screaming from him? Warning, this title contains the following: explicit sex and graphic language.

There just wasn't much to this one. Depressed after being fired by her sexist boss, Willow has a "night on the town" with her wild big sister and is dared into flirting with a random guy. She haplessly picks Seth, a vampire, and the two of are so attracted to each other that she goes home with him. It turns out that they're mates (although this isn't stressed as heavily as it is in other similar paranormals), which means he can't feed from anyone else. However, even though they have good chemistry, Willow is terrified when she finds out he's a vampire and has trouble accepting his nature, while he rapidly becomes resentful of her unfair and judgmental attitude.

I really like romance novels that have a lot of background for the characters, including bad experiences they have to work through, insecurities they need to reassure one another about, etc. I also like romance novels to have some subplot, like some villain in the background who towards the end of the novel becomes impossible to ignore. This book was basically just sex with a couple of arguments. Neither Seth nor Willow was all that interesting; they were pretty ordinary adults with a somewhat unique problem that they handled kind of immaturely. Willow in particular, resenting him for not asking before he drank her blood, seemed totally ridiculous to me. I'm not critical of her for not wanting to be with a vampire or anything, but being angry because he drank without asking seemed so ridiculous. I also found the sex scenes too long and boring. But in all fairness, I'm not really into those scenes unless they've got a lot of dialogue and interesting inner monologue.
